    Job Description


    Description: Summary:
    The main function of a warehouse supervisor is to oversee warehouse employees in order to meet business objectives for assigned departments regarding safety, quality productivity, responsiveness, and more.
    Job Responsibilities:
    •Counsel and support hourly employees with needs/concerns as required.
    •Address performance behaviors by commending those that are positives and discouraging those that are negative.
    •Uses Quality Network problem solving process to address opportunities within area and engage work force for ideas.
    •Apply Workplace Organization (WPO) process to improve layouts and efficiency.
    •Perform daily Timekeeping System (TKS) updating to ensure accurate processing of payroll data.
    •Use A-3 reporting format to document problem solving activities and observe local A-3 guidelines.
    •Conduct daily meetings to communicate business performance and have two-way discussions with employees.
    •Perform and document weekly safety observation tours of departments.
    •Plan daily workloads in advance.
    •Support colleagues to optimize shift performance.
    •Observe contractual requirements (National and Local).
    •Enforce Shop Rules.
    •Perform daily SOP audit checks.
    •Advance skills through Individual Development Plan (IDP) process.
    •Keep General Supervisor Shop Committee apprised of all pending activities.
    Skills:
    •Knowledge of manufacturing processes and procedures.
    •Knowledge of basic math.
    •Strong written and verbal communications skills.
    •Understand of basic technology of area where assigned.
    •Knowledge of scheduling and other management systems.
    •Relatively high level of analytical ability where problems are complex.
    •Strong interpersonal skills to work effectively with others, motivate employees and elicit work output.
    •Knowledge of quality control procedures.
    Education/Experience:
    •High school graduate with at least 1-2 years of technical or business school training.
    •Training in skilled trades area or equivalent technical training.
    •5-7 years of experience required.
